Understanding Soffit and FasciaBefore delving into repair methods, it's important to understand what soffit and fascia are. What is Soffit?Soffit is the product that covers the underside of the eaves of a roof. It is generally vented to permit air flow into the attic space, which helps in controling temperature level and wetness levels. Appropriate ventilation is necessary to prevent mold development and structural damage. What is Fascia?Fascia, on the other hand, is the horizontal board that runs along the edge of the roofline. It serves as a support structure for the lower edge of the roofing tiles or shingles and plays an essential function in securing the roof from water damage by directing rainwater into the gutter system. Common Issues with Soffit and FasciaGradually, soffit and fascia can struggle with different problems due to direct exposure to the components, bugs, or absence of maintenance. Here are some typical issues: 1. Water DamageWater damage is among the most prevalent concerns. If gutters are clogged or harmed, water can overflow and cause rot or staining in both soffit and fascia. 2. Insect InfestationSoffit Installation is frequently a target for insects such as bees, wasps, and rodents. Infestations can cause further damage if not attended to quickly. 3. Mold and MildewDue to moisture accumulation, mold and mildew can develop, resulting in health concerns and structural damage. 4. Maintenance Tips for Soffit and FasciaPreventative maintenance can extend the life of soffit and fascia and minimize the requirement for repairs. Here are some maintenance suggestions: 1. Routine InspectionsConduct visual examinations a minimum of twice a year, particularly after severe weather condition events. 2. Clean GuttersKeep rain gutters clear of debris to prevent water overflow. 3. Ensure VentilationPreserve appropriate ventilation in the attic to prevent moisture accumulation. 4. Paint and SealUse paint or sealant to secure wooden soffit and fascia from wetness and bugs. 5.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How do I understand if my soffit or fascia requires repair?Look for indications like water discolorations, visible mold, bugs, or physical damage such as warping or cracking. Q2: Can I repair soffit and fascia myself?While minor repairs can be taken on by homeowners with some DIY abilities, it is suggested to consult specialists for comprehensive damage or structural concerns. Q3: What products are utilized for soffit and fascia?Common products include w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iber cement. Each has its pros and cons in regards to sturdiness and maintenance. Q4: How often should I maintain soffit and fascia?Routine evaluations must be done a minimum of two times a year, with immediate attention given to any problems that develop. Q5: Is it needed to paint my soffit and fascia?If they are made of wood, routine painting or sealing is necessary to secure them from wetness and pests.
